Umarga Population - Osmanabad, Maharashtra
Umarga is a medium size village located in Tuljapur Taluka of Osmanabad district, Maharashtra with total 403 families residing. The Umarga village has population of 1899 of which 964 are males while 935 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Umarga village population of children with age 0-6 is 271 which makes up 14.27 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Umarga village is 970 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Umarga as per census is 1069, higher than Maharashtra average of 894.
Umarga village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Umarga village was 76.60 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Umarga Male literacy stands at 85.47 % while female literacy rate was 67.30 %.

Umarga Data
|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total No. of Houses | 403 | - | - |
| Population | 1,899 | 964 | 935 |
| Child (0-6) | 271 | 131 | 140 |
| Schedule Caste | 255 | 139 | 116 |
| Schedule Tribe | 32 | 17 | 15 |
| Literacy | 76.60 % | 85.47 % | 67.30 % |
| Total Workers | 854 | 524 | 330 |
| Main Worker | 826 | - | - |
| Marginal Worker | 28 | 16 | 12 |
